🐞 Description
El Capitan Installation Fails, and this installer may be lost to humanity if no one fixes it.
When I create the bootable installer for OS X Capitan 11.6 and run it,
I get an error message saying:
OS X could not be installed on your computer
An error occurred while extracting files from the package "Essentials.pkg".
Quit the installer to restart your computer and try again.
I thought there might be something wrong with the flash drive, but I used a USB SSD drive as the installer, and I got the same exact message. So there is something wrong with the package.
